Output ddfb165889d965d2940668a45d045fbe089b9bfe807e6a830280f9ba850fa855:2

value
697925831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e021e934b98cd54457224beffa1e7d9e87ed8c6 OP_EQUAL
address
32y5vVPeiwpDimjZndVbhhk8q3EPxJ6zAe
transaction
ddfb165889d965d2940668a45d045fbe089b9bfe807e6a830280f9ba850fa855
spent
true